261 Dunstable Road is a residential building situated on Dunstable Road, Luton, LU4 with 2 addresses.
It ranks as the 72nd largest and 203rd most expensive of the 309 buildings in the LU4 area. The dominant property type is a period flat built between 1800 and 1911.
The building contains a total of 2 properties: 2 flats.
Sale prices range from £168,128 for 3 bedroom Leasehold flats (688 ft2) to £187,938 for 7 bedroom Leasehold flats (1,076 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,127 pcm for 3 bed flats to £1,309 pcm for 7 bed flats.
The gross rental yield is between 8.0% and 8.4%.
The average value per square foot is £209.
The closest station to 261, Dunstable Road, Luton, LU4 8BP is Luton station which is 1.6 kilometres away.
